Living in the North Queensland comes with its own set of hardships, especially when it comes to the threat of cyclones. However, there's a smart solution: cyclone-proof kit homes. These prefabricated structures are designed to withstand the strongest winds and torrential rains, giving you peace of mind through these extreme weather events.
These kit home features robust materials and construction techniques that satisfy strict cyclone building codes. From reinforced walls and roofs to secure windows and doors, every element is carefully considered to ensure maximum protection.
Moreover, the benefits reach just weather resistance. Kit homes are often budget-friendly than traditional builds, and they can be erected much quickly. This means you can have your dream home up and running in no time, without the stress associated with a lengthy construction process.

Constructing Your Dream Home: Cyclone Rated Kits in North Qld
Dreaming of a sturdy and attractive home that can withstand the forces of nature? Look no further than cyclone rated kits! In North Queensland, where tropical storms are a common occurrence, these pre-engineered structures offer an ideal solution for homeowners seeking both comfort and peace of mind. A cyclone rated kit provides all the components needed to build a house that can endure high winds and heavy rainfall. This means you can enjoy your dream home without constantly worrying about the potential damage from severe weather events.
Constructing a cyclone rated kit is a straightforward process, with most kits designed for quick and efficient assembly. The pre-cut lumber and other materials are delivered directly to your site, minimizing the need for on-site cutting and preparation. Experienced builders can typically complete the construction within a reasonable timeframe, allowing you to move into your new home sooner.
The benefits of choosing a cyclone rated kit extend beyond just protection from storms. These kits are often energy-efficient, helping you save money on utility bills and reduce your environmental impact. They also tend to be more affordable than traditional construction methods, making them an attractive option for budget-conscious homeowners.
Choosing the right cyclone rated kit for your needs is crucial. Consider factors such as the area of your desired home, the specific climate conditions in your region, and your personal needs. Research different manufacturers and explore their offerings to find a kit that best aligns with your vision and budget.
